Transaction 99f43a2ce251c5929a5a210f729a774a85e31fb7eba1b2eff81d6c26263542f4

1 Input
2 Outputs
  • 99f43a2ce251c5929a5a210f729a774a85e31fb7eba1b2eff81d6c26263542f4:0
  • value  1572094260
    address  1F1oYUDezmKdBtrCmBP5NWZrapap4vjSm
  • 99f43a2ce251c5929a5a210f729a774a85e31fb7eba1b2eff81d6c26263542f4:1
  • value  30000000
    address  14DtgPnN7jhb6y1Wz8yYGKNiPunt4h5euZ